Rosiglitazone is not associated with an increased risk of bladder cancer

Article ID Journal Published Year Pages File Type
10897386 Cancer Epidemiology 2013 5 Pages PDF
Abstract
Rosiglitazone does not increase the risk of bladder cancer.
